Goals and Objectives

  • Expanding the organization and increasing the number of members, identifying the second and third generations, and strengthening ties with the descendants of the community scattered around the world (especially in the United States and Argentina).
  • Collectingand concentrating documents, certificates, photos and other material of historical value and sentiment relating to Siedlce Community. By collecting this and uploading it to the organization’s website, the realization of the vision will be advanced.
  • Locating1st Generation members who were born in Siedlce, and haven’t yet given their testimonies. Encouragement to write down memories, grasping this last chance to preserve personal and family stories.
  • Organizing yearly “Shorashim” journeys to The journeys will be plannedso enough time is allocated to visit Siedlce and its environment, and enabling those interested in doing so to locate families’ addresses and to visit the city’s archive. A tour to Treblinka, where most members of the community were destroyed will be organized.
  • Helppreparing family trees and genealogy research of community members.
  • Organizationof meetings from time to time for community members, including meeting of the different generations, hearing stories of the 1st generation, and strengthening the connection and the affinity to the community among the 2nd and 3rd At these gatherings the 2nd and 3rd generations’ members will have the opportunity to ask questions, identify Photos from family albums and more.
  • In particular- Once a year a meeting shall be organized to be an annual event of “Yizkor for the community of Siedlce.
  • Publishinga quarterly bulletin that will be sent to all organization’s members with updates, stories, photos and more items relating to the community.
  • Rehabilitationand rescue of the Jewish cemetery in Siedlce. The Committee shal initiate actions to achieve cooperation with responsible entities in Siedlce that may help to save the area of the cemetery, which is now in jeopardy in light of the local plans threatening it. The current situation in the cemetery is shocking and intensive activity is required for this purpose.
  • Cooperation withSiedlce Municipality in converting an existing building to the museum and a memorial to the Jews of Siedlce.
  • Preservation, maintenance and expansion of the organization’s website. This requires assistance from the community’s members – whether in locating and supplying new documents and photographs for scanning and publishing, or in donations – for the purpose of the continued operations, upgrades, translations etc.
